How they compare

Iceland currently reports 2 t against 0 t in Pakistan, a difference of 2 t.

Across all 12 years both countries report, Iceland has been ahead every year.

Iceland ranks 57th and Pakistan ranks 60th of 69 countries.

Iceland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The Fertilizers by Product dataset contains information on the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ers products. The fertilizer statistics data are for a set of 23 product categories.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
